Roman Anthony's ascent within the Red Sox organization has been rapid. After a mid-season debut in 2025, he quickly adapted to major league pitching, displaying a combination of power and plate discipline rarely seen in rookies. His .336/.439/.564 batting line in the leadoff spot over his final 27 games underscores his potential to set the tone for the Red Sox offense.
Bleacher Report's projection of Anthony potentially leading the team in home runs speaks volumes about his expected impact. While Trevor Story had a strong 2025 season with 25 home runs, Anthony's raw talent and potential for growth position him as a likely candidate to surpass that number.
